				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><strong>Hollow</strong></p>
<p><strong>An exhibition by Jenny Hall</strong></p>
<p><strong>Undegun – Regent Street – Wrexham</strong></p>
<p>Wrexham’s creative space Undegun will be welcoming Hollow, by Machynlleth based Artist Jenny Hall, which will delve into new territory for the pop up arts centre, creating a space-within-a-space as a large architectural structure is given form by the artist. The exhibition also challenges the public to experiment with building their own structures from the blocks.</p>
<p>Taking a copper mine as a source of inspiration, this exhibition explores the creative destruction involved in the act of construction. The mine was represented as a large hollow sculpture at the Aberystwyth Arts Centre where loose cardboard boxes represented the ‘ore’ that had been extracted from inside. As the touring exhibition also explores displacement: of an idea, of a material, Hollow has been re-imagined for Undegun in a new form. Cardboard boxes are the perfect material for expressing a thing displaced. These connect together with magnets.</p>
<p>Jenny invited award winning Welsh architecture practice Rural Office for Architecture to create a design using her building block system for Undegun. Their exploded spherical form lends itself to the arts centre’s program of music and dance performance.</p>
<p>Hollow will also be re-imagined when it travels to the Muni centre in Pontypridd. Constructed on a large mirrored floor, it encourages visitors to consider the relationship between the spaces we create above and below the ground.</p>
<p><em>“</em><em>Mines have faded in our minds as we no longer reach for the coal scuttle or travel by steam engine, but we continue to rapidly build a world on the surface of the same size if not the same shape as the subterranean world that we excavate.”</em></p>
<p>The public are invited to move, stack, connect and build with the loose boxes and the scale model to explore building structures and creating empty space.</p>
<p>Jenny is the director of architectural design practice craftedspace.co.uk</p>
<p>‘Hollow’ will be on display to the public from Saturday, 21<sup>st</sup> May, and there will be a programme of events and performances during the run of the exhibition providing a chance to meet the artist and Architect Niall Maxwell of Rural office for Architecture to discuss how structures are created and how people identify with and use these spaces.</p>
